Programmable Logic Controllers (PLCs) are industrial digital computers that are widely used to control and monitor industrial processes, machines, and systems. They are designed to automate tasks, improve efficiency, and enhance productivity in various industries, including manufacturing, oil and gas, water treatment, and more.

John W. Webb’s textbook provides a structured introduction to PLC technology. It bridges the gap between theoretical electrical sequencing and practical industrial execution. The book is highly regarded for its clear explanations, step-by-step programming examples, and emphasis on real-world troubleshooting.
